Abstract

Glioblastoma is the most aggressive and fatal primary brain tumor in adults, characterized by poor prognosis and limited treatment efficacy due to the impermeability of the blood-brain barrier (BBB) and its treatment-resistant nature. This review aims to evaluate the potential of intranasal terpene treatment (ITT) as a novel and non-invasive strategy to bypass the BBB and improve glioblastoma treatment outcomes. A review of recent preclinical and clinical studies on intranasally administered compounds (especially terpenes such as Perillyl alcohol (POH)) is presented in terms of their molecular mechanisms, bioavailability, and clinical effects in the central nervous system (CNS).
